Output 20c58cc317748d2422ff47e8add81deb76507a6466cd22023fa1d93f2d7c4773:0

value
632703
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84ef899186baaa6bc077a99014d462824ff2ea98 OP_EQUALVERIFY OP_CHECKSIG
address
1D7u9ft156fC5FsuW6qEMMSG2i7xtut1qh
transaction
20c58cc317748d2422ff47e8add81deb76507a6466cd22023fa1d93f2d7c4773
spent
true